    A Ceylon cut is a mixed cut in which the sides of the stone are cut into steps ascending to a brilliant cut center. Rose Cut. The rose cut was developed in 1520 and was often used for garnets. A rose cut has a round, cabochon base and a faceted top with a regular pattern of triangular facets. Barion Cut

    The Darya-e Noor diamond is a pale pink table cut gemstone. Improved gem cutting techniques enabled lapidaries to cut facets into gemstones. Facets are the flat, polished surfaces or planes of a finished stone. In the past, many stones were table cut, which amounted to creating a single polished face.
